Getting to know the Sussex shore with Pagham Harbour marine madness

The sixth annual 'marine madness' '“ the biggest event of the year at Pagham Harbour '“ takes place tomorrow (Sunday, August 16).

Its aim is to raise awareness of the West Sussex shoreline and the marine environment, and it links in with South East Marine Week.

The event will be from midday to 5.30pm, at the harbour visitor centre in Selsey Road, Sidlesham.

Activities will include touch tables of local strandline finds, a marine aquarium, guided walks, a discovery trail, a bouncy castle, a gift and book stall and refreshments.

The British Divers Marine Life Rescue will also be at the event with life-size inflatable marine mammals, and will be running interactive demonstrations of rescues.

And for 3.50, visitors can buy a Pirate Pass which entitles children to art activities, story-telling, face-painting and creative cookies. No booking is necessary.
